Product Description

Discover How to Profit from Your Craft
Have you ever dreamed of learning how to make fragrant soaps? You can! Soapmaking For Fun & Profit was written with two purposes in mind: to teach you the basics of this fun craft and to show you how to turn these new skills into cash! Whether you've been crafting for years or are just getting started, you'll learn:
·The benefits and enjoyment of soapmaking
·The right materials, tools, and equipment to use
·How to create a special "crafting place" in your home
·Ways to sell your creations at craft shows, shops, and other outlets
·Craft business basics, including pricing and record keeping
·And much more!

One of the best books on the market about soap making!5
I have many books on soap making and they are pretty much all the same.... all someone else's recipes. I have been searching for one that would give me the "base" formula and I found that in this book. You get a short history in how soap began, and thorough explanations on the different oils, fats, butters, and scents.... how each is used and what they do for your soap. It even explains the different aromatherapy characteristics of the fragrance and essential oils. There is a wonderful explanation on how to calculate the saponification values that even an 8 year old could understand. Yes there are a few recipes to get you started in each type of soap making (melt & pour, hand milled, rebatched, and cold processed), but mostly you are encouraged to create you own recipes.

The business part is also one of the most thorough I have found. It covers licenses and permits, copy right laws rights and wrongs, FDA labeling rules, taxes laws, and so much more. This book is a must have for beginners and experienced soap crafters alike!

Good book for the business info3
This book is great if you already know how to make soap and want to start a business. It goes through the legal info you need to know to register a business name, get a bank account, accept credit cards, get a website, etc. And it is pretty decent for beginners learning how to make soap. There are a lot of suppliers listed and the instructions are pretty good. The only bad thing is that the book focuses more on melt & pour or hand milled soaps rather than true cold process soaps. The cold process recipes are very limited... one using just lard, one using just tallow, and one using just vegetable shortening. Yuck! If you *really* want to start a soap business, you're going to need a book that gives you recipes using coconut, palm, and olive oil - the basics for making soap. So get this if you already know the basics but have no clue where to start business-wise. If you are completely new to soapmaking, get The Handmade Soap Book by Melinda Coss.
